本文面向在电脑上连接TokenPocket(简称TP)或类似热钱包的开发者、产品与安全人员,从防CSRF攻击、合约调用安全、专家视角、创新科技走向、通证经济设计到代币升级策略,提供系统化分析与实用建议。
一、防CSRF攻击(跨站请求伪造)
场景:用户在桌面浏览器打开DApp并请求TP签名或发送交易时,攻击者可能诱导请求在用户不知情下被触发。防护要点:
- 严格校验来源:DApp应验证window.origin与后端请求中的来源,Wallet端也应展示来源信息并拒绝不匹配请求。
- 持久化挑战/Nonce:所有签名与敏感操作加入一次性challenge或时间戳,避免重放。
- 使用EIP-712结构化签名:让用户可读字段明确定义签名含义,减少误签风险。
- 同站Cookie与SameSite:后端会话使用SameSite=strict/strict-like策略,避免跨站请求携带会话凭证。
- 最小权限与确认步骤:对敏感权限(如approve大额allowance、合约升级)进行二次确认或多签。
二、合约调用策略与风险管控
- 调用类型区分:read-only调用可直接RPC获取,write调用必须通过钱包签名并展示完整交易信息(to/value/data/gas)。
- 避免approve无限授权:推荐使用ERC-20的permit或允许限定额度的approve,并在DApp提示剩余额度与来源合约地址。
- 气费与回退处理:前端估算gas并提示用户合理上限;合约应设计清晰的错误码与event便于排查。
- 元交易与代付:采用meta-tx时需对relayer做KYC/信誉评估,并保证nonce机制在relayer端防止重放。
三、专家分析要点(风险、合规与治理)
- 安全层次化:合约审计、模糊测试、形式化验证(对关键逻辑)与运行时监控相结合。
- 事件响应与保险:部署速查/回滚机制、bug bounty与链上/链下应急基金安排。
- 合规考量:代币分发、空投与治理机制需考虑监管披露与KYC/AML策略。

四、创新科技走向
- 账户抽象与智能账户(Account Abstraction):提升账户可编程性,支持社交恢复、限额签名与按需验证器。
- 多方计算(MPC)与阈值签名:替代单一私钥,提高设备与服务的容错性。
- 零知识证明(ZK)与隐私保护:在合规与隐私之间寻找平衡,如可验证但不泄露细节的交易证明。
- 跨链与光速桥接:更安全的跨链通信协议与去中心化守护者网络将影响钱包设计。
五、通证经济(Tokenomics)设计要点

- 经济模型清晰化:发行总量、通胀/通缩机制、流动性挖矿与代币锁仓策略需对齐长期激励。
- 价值捕获与使用场景:确保代币在生态内有明确的消耗路径(手续费、治理、独享功能)。
- 防暴力囤积与操纵:设置时间锁、线性释放、反鲸机制与治理门槛。
六、代币升级与迁移策略
- 合约可升级性:采用代理模式(透明/可升级代理)或模块化可替换组件,同时控制升级权与多签审计。
- 平滑迁移方案:链上快照+时间窗口的swap合约,或由治理投票触发自动迁移;保留旧链历史以便审计。
- 用户体验与信任:提前通告、提供工具化一键迁移路径,并对重大变更做模拟与回滚方案。
七、实践清单(快速核验)
- DApp端:强制EIP-712签名、展示origin与human-readable字段、限制approve额度、采用nonce防重放。
- Wallet端:清晰来源展示、拒绝隐藏参数、对敏感权限做二次确认、支持硬件/外设签名与MPC。
- 团队:审计+回滚计划+监控告警+治理透明度。
结语:在电脑环境中连接TP钱包时,安全不仅是单点技术的问题,而是体系化的设计——从防CSRF的边界控制到合约调用的安全约束,再到通证经济与代币升级的治理方案,均需前瞻性的安全与产品权衡。通过采用EIP-712、账户抽象、MPC与严格的审计与迁移流程,可以在保护用户资产的同时推动创新科技落地。
评论
CryptoLiu
很全面,尤其赞同用EIP-712减少误签的建议。
链上小张
关于代币升级的平滑迁移方案说得很到位,建议再补充多签延迟窗口的具体时长策略。
Eva_Wallet
MPC和账户抽象的结合是未来方向,希望能看到更多实践案例。
安全顾问小雷
加上运行时监控和自动告警非常重要,文章覆盖的应急流程很实用。